Open Access Statement
Smart: Journal of Public Health (SPubHealth) is steadfastly committed to the principles of open scientific exchange. We operate as a fully Open Access journal, driven by the belief that removing paywalls and freely sharing research with the global public accelerates discovery, supports health equity, and fosters a greater international exchange of knowledge.
Unrestricted Access
In strict accordance with the Budapest Open Access Initiative (BOAI) definition of open access, all content published in SPubHealth is immediately and freely available without charge to the user or their affiliated institution.
Upon publication, readers are unequivocally permitted to:
-
Read, download, and copy the full text of all articles.
-
Distribute, print, and search the content.
-
Crawl the articles for indexing.
-
Pass them as data to software or use them for any other lawful, non-commercial, or commercial purpose.
No Prior Permission Required
Users may exercise these rights without seeking prior permission from the publisher, the editorial board, or the original author(s).
This immediate, unrestricted access is facilitated by the journal's use of the Creative Commons Attribution-ShareAlike 4.0 International License (CC BY-SA 4.0). Users must simply ensure that proper attribution is given to the original author(s) and SPubHealth as the initial venue of publication, and that any derivative works are distributed under the exact same license.
